Marsha Vlasic Signs PJ Harvey


NEW YORK (CelebrityAccess) — Marsha Vlasic, president of Artist Group International, has signed UK musician PJ Harvey for representation in the U.S. and Canada.

Harvey, whose experimental alt-rock has been adored by critics and garnered her a cult following of devoted fans, is perhaps best known to U.S. audiences for her 1995 album "To Bring You My Love" with its surprise hit "Down by the water" which earned Harvey extensive airplay.

Harvey has stronger name recognition in Europe and her most recent album, 2011's "Let England Shake" debuted on the UK charts at #8 and was certified gold in Denmark. Harvey is currently in the studio in Somerset, with producer John Parish working on her 9th studio album.

In January, she staged live recording sessions, inviting fans into a specially designed studio to watch the work in progress from behind soundproofed, one way glass.

Vlasic reports that she has followed PJ Harvey’s career and has been a fan for decades.

"I am incredibly honored and excited to work with such an amazing artist." – Vlasic said in a press statement. “Having this opportunity is extremely thrilling and I can’t wait to share her talents and expand her touring in the United States and Canada.” – Staff Writers
